Determination of lead, cadmium and nickel concentrations in serum samples (n=50), collected from policemen at difference checkpoint in Karbala governorate, was carried out by flam atomic absorption spectrometer. The results show, that the Pb, Cd and Ni mean value were (1.016±0.052)ppb, (0.043±0.007)ppb and (0.212±0.015)ppb respectively. The result also show that the mean values of heavy elements in serum samples were higher in policemen group when compared to control group, where the statistically significantly difference (p 0.05).
